How to Choose the Right Cooler

When shopping for a tailgate cooler under $200 prioritize the features you’ll actually use: insulation performance, portability (wheels or straps), durability for rough lots, and extras like cup holders, pockets, and easy-clean liners. Soft-sided coolers are lighter and compressible for storage but typically retain ice for shorter periods than rigid roto-molded coolers. Wheeled soft coolers and rolling carts add mobility—look for multi-direction spinner wheels and a solid telescoping handle if you’re crossing pavement or long parking rows. Pay attention to the liner: heat-sealed PVC or similar materials reduce leaks and simplify cleanup, but seams and zippers are common failure points so inspect construction and reinforced bottoms.

Also think about capacity vs. size. For a small group a 24–36-can soft-sided cooler is often ideal; larger hard coolers hold more ice for longer but are heavier to tote. Cup holders are handy at a tailgate—either built into a chair (see our chair picks) or as molded features on some coolers. Durability matters: reinforced stitching, stronger fabric (e.g., 600D polyester), and rigid base plates stand up better to repeated use. Finally, consider value: in this budget bracket expect trade-offs—more features and better wheels at the mid-range, basic logos and light construction at the lowest price.

Frequently Asked Questions

Soft-sided or hard-sided — which is better for tailgates?

Soft-sided coolers are lighter, more portable, and easier to store, making them great for short tailgates and quick trips. Hard-sided coolers typically keep ice longer and are more durable for multi-day use, but they’re heavier to carry. Choose soft-sided if mobility and storage are priorities; choose hard-sided if long ice retention is essential.

Do wheeled coolers work well on grass and gravel?

Wheels make a big difference on pavement and packed surfaces. Spinner wheels are excellent on flat lots but smaller wheels can struggle on soft grass or gravel. If you often cross uneven terrain, look for models with larger, rubber-coated wheels or consider a cooler cart designed for rough ground.

How can I prevent leaks from a soft cooler?

Make sure the liner is heat-sealed and that zippers and seams are well-constructed. Use a secondary waterproof tray inside if you expect lots of melt water, and avoid overfilling with ice so water can drain to a designated spout if present. Wiping down and drying the cooler after use prolongs liner life.
